Rhino Harlequin it is one of the two masks, together with hippo Ballerina, from the late-Renaissance “Commedia dell'arte”. It's part of the artist's series “Carnival of the animals”, from the musical suite of the same name, written by the French composer Camille Saint-Saens, which transform animal attributes into music. These two characters maintain their aura as lucky subjects in the figurative arts from the 16th century to the present day.
The timid posture and good-hearted rhino Harlequin is dressed in clad in a yellow and blue diamond suit with a cloth ruffle. It is a clear tribute to Picasso's harlequins representations and also a passionate homage to the work of the great master of pencil-drawn dreams, Walt Disney.
